Fix several problems with gift registry api

This commit is contained in:
2025-03-16 20:23:52 +01:00
parent 54fbed2816
commit 1a18347e93
4 changed files with 33 additions and 18 deletions

View File

@@ -271,11 +271,12 @@ def get_event_by_slug(
db: Session = Depends(get_db),
slug: str,
access_code: Optional[str] = Query(None),
current_user: Optional[User] = Depends(get_current_user)
current_user: Optional[User] = Depends(get_optional_current_user)
) -> EventResponse:
"""Get event by slug."""
try:
event_obj = event_crud.get_by_slug(db=db, slug=slug)
print(f"Event {event_obj}")
return validate_event_access(
db=db,
event_obj=event_obj,